SUMMARY

"In Copper Crucible, Jonathan D. Rosenblum, a labor lawyer who was formerly a newspaper and magazine journalist, reveals how much fight still resides in union hearts, but also why miltancy is often not enough. He thus brings down to earth the glib judgments about labor's woes issued by many journalists and scholars.
